Handover: Wrenstone Audio Guide

For the security review: I'm passing the Wrenstone museum guide app to Priya. Token exchange for exhibit streams was reworked last sprint — guest sessions now expire after the gallery closes, and offline packs are signed. Pen-test findings from Q2 are all closed except the CDN header item. Current service configuration follows.

settings of bafof-fajog:
[aldix]
port = 9300
region = north-3
host = aldix.kelvilabs.example
team = istath
timeout_ms = 1500
retries = 8

### Action Item: Spoolhaven Retry Storm

From last Tuesday's outage: the Spoolhaven print service retried failed jobs without backoff, saturating the render pool. Fix merged; retries now use capped exponential backoff with jitter. Owner will monitor for a week before closing. The agreed retry constants are recorded below.

constants for yadup-kajof:
RATE_LIMITS = {
    "zorwyn": 1,
    "druwyn": 1,
}

## Runbook: Tillgate user-module split

The user module has been extracted from the Tillgate monolith into a standalone service called Keyward. Authentication tokens are now minted by Keyward and validated by the monolith via a shared verification key; session writes no longer touch the monolith database. Password hashing parameters were unchanged during the split. For the security review, the extracted service runs with the following configuration values.

config for kafof-bawef:
holath:
  log_level: debug
  metrics_host: metrics.holath.qorvelsys.internal
  pin: 2191
  pool_size: 32

Ticket: Missed pick-up – Reservoir water samples

The scheduled courier failed to collect the chilled sample crate from Merrowvale Reservoir intake at 07:00. Samples remain viable until 18:00 today. A replacement run is confirmed for 14:00. Shift lead: keep the crate refrigerated and staged at Bay 2. The courier must follow the hand-over instruction noted below.

handover note for yagef-bagep: the drudor pelius courier leaves the kasdor zorvan norir ledger at gate 8016 under passcode 755406